Thomas Hooper "Resonant Divide A & B" Giclee Print

Thomas Hooper is a dynamic visual artist based in the United Kingdom, celebrated for his influential contributions to the tattoo community. His work explores profound themes of love, spirituality, and mortality, often expressed through intricate geometric illustrations that provoke deep contemplation.

Resonant Divide A & B
Acrylic on paper mounted on birch panel
Each 58 × 96 cm (approx.)

"Resonant Divide A & B is a diptych exploring the tension and harmony between microcosmic and macrocosmic forces. Through solid, geometric fields of layered colour, the paintings investigate the dual nature of vibration—light, sound, and matter—distilled into abstract visual form. Each panel acts as a counterpart to the other, revealing subtle shifts in tone, density, and energy.

Built through deliberate layering rather than reduction, the surfaces retain a sense of stillness and presence, with flat expanses that suggest both internal and external landscapes. Together, the works form an abstract dialogue between states of expansion and compression, perhaps echoing the unseen forces that shape our universe." - TH
